The latest agreement reflects a shared emphasis on operating within regulated markets and adapting content to local requirements. Both companies have highlighted the importance of aligning products with regional preferences while meeting compliance standards.
Jani Kontturi, Head of Games at SkillOnNet said: “Portugal, Brazil, Greece and Peru are all strategically important markets for SkillOnNet, and working with Playtech allows us to deliver premium content that resonates with local players while meeting each market’s regulatory requirements.”
Marat Koss, Chief Interactive Gaming Officer at Playtech, commented: “We're excited to expand our longstanding collaboration with SkillOnNet into new markets and bring our next-gen iBingo platform to new players. The multi-market launch serves as both a strong testament to the quality of our technology and the trust placed in our long-term Bingo strategy. We look forward to continued shared success with a valued partner.”
The rollout strengthens the ongoing partnership between Playtech and SkillOnNet, with both companies continuing to focus on expanding their presence across regulated markets through content integration and targeted campaigns.
